With the Easy Updates Manager plugin for WordPress, keeping all of your plugins up to date has never been easier.
Once you’ve installed this plugin, all of your updates can be accessed from one dashboard page, and auto-update for plugins can easily be turned on (or off). You can also use the plugin to enable (or disable) global updates and updates for WordPress core. You can even use the plugin to manage your theme updates — in fact you can pretty much use it to manage any type of WordPress update there could be to make sure it happens automatically (or not).
